In Web3, assets like tokens and NFTs are decentralized, but the data behind them often remains centralized. Walrus is solving this fundamental contradiction by transforming data into a trustless, on-chain resource. With Walrus, developers can store data that is verifiable, encrypted, and fully programmable, eliminating reliance on centralized servers that introduce censorship and downtime risks.
Walrus enables precise access control, meaning data owners decide who can read, write, or monetize their information. This is especially important for applications dealing with sensitive or high-value data, such as financial records, AI training datasets, or digital media assets. Every version of data is traceable, creating transparency and accountability by default.
By making data composable and interoperable with smart contracts, Walrus unlocks entirely new design spaces for decentralized applications. It shifts data from being a passive dependency into an active economic asset within Web3 ecosystems.
